Denmark - Healthcare Expenditure on Therapeutic Appliances and Medical Durable Goods by Retailers of Medical Goods

Since 2014, Denmark Healthcare Expenditure on Therapeutic Appliances and Medical Durable Goods by Retailers of Medical Goods jumped by 2.3%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 5 comparing other countries in Healthcare Expenditure on Therapeutic Appliances and Medical Durable Goods by Retailers of Medical Goods at €187.1 Per Capita. Denmark is overtaken by Norway, which was ranked number 4 at €208.72 Per Capita and is followed by Netherlands with €178.23 Per Capita. Germany topped the ranking with €239.84 Per Capita in 2019, an increase of 2.5% versus 2018. Lithuania witnessed the best average annual growth at +16% per year, while Cyprus recorded the worst performance at -8.8% per year.
